Question Collection Letter has Wrong Name on It

AFNI (Old ALLTEL bill) has a colllections item on my account stating that I owe $495.81. This is showing up on Transunion and Experian. The collection letter has my name spelled completely wrong. Can I dispute and say that it's not mine based on the name? If so, do I just send that information directly to Transunion and Experian. For example, can I send a copy of the collections letter along with a copy of my driver's license and ss card to the credit reporting agencies or do I have to start with AFNI?

Thanks in advance for your help.

You can try disputing with the CRAs first.
If this is your first time disputing with the CRAs, then it is a good idea to send a copy of your DL (with your current address) and ss#.. then they can't give you the typical bs stall letter that they need you to prove your identity.

Before you dispute this though.... make sure to opt out and delete/update all of your personal info first. You can do this online or by phone and it usually goes a little more quickly so you can move on to your "regular" disputes.

So can I just send a print out of the notice from AFNI with the wrong name, a copy of my DL and SS card direct to the CRA with a letter stating this is not mine b/c it is not listed in the right name? Also should I send it out certified with return receipt requested?

I wouldn't send the AFNI letter... It's just not necessary... they have all of that info.
You should just say it's not yours (don't mention name spelling or anything else)..and you have no knowledge or records of such acct.

Send out disputes to CRAs CM only.... but not RR.
